Young People Practitioner

Employer: Southampton City Council
Contract: Initial 3 months
Hours: 37 per week
Pay Rate: £21.14 per hour (Umbrella) | £19.32 per hour (PAYE exclusive)

Southampton City Council is currently seeking an experienced and passionate Youth Practitioner to join an established and expanding service supporting young people affected by serious youth violence, exploitation, and complex safeguarding needs.

This is an exciting opportunity to be part of a child-first, trauma-informed and contextual safeguarding approach, working directly with young people who may struggle to engage with statutory services. You will play a vital role in building trusted relationships and delivering intensive, flexible support that responds to risk, need, and lived experience.

Key Responsibilities:
  • Build and sustain trusting, relationship-based engagement with young people
  • Co-produce child-centred support plans that reflect voice, identity, and lived experience
  • Deliver intensive, flexible, and creative outreach-based support
  • Work in partnership with Police and wider multi-agency teams using a focused deterrence approach
  • Contribute to contextual safeguarding responses in peer groups, places, and communities
  • Maintain accurate, high-quality case recording in line with safeguarding and legal requirements
  • Regularly review and adapt support plans in response to risk and progress
About You:

We are looking for practitioners who are:
  • Experienced in working with young people affected by extrafamilial harm, exploitation, or serious youth violence
  • Skilled in trauma-informed, relationship-based practice
  • Able to build trust through persistence, empathy, and consistency
  • Confident working within multi-agency safeguarding environments, including Police
  • Flexible, reflective, and resilient in high-risk or complex situations
  • Committed to child-first and anti-oppressive practice
This is a unique opportunity to join a supportive, reflective team delivering an evidence-informed programme that is making a real impact on safety, harm reduction, and outcomes for young people.
